Output e66f5a53652b201562019bfbee0433d0426105309b724d51a183d6aac7e50668:0

value
2270940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e25b14986d8dfb7a3011f15e7938573d069d1ba2 OP_EQUALVERIFY OP_CHECKSIG
address
1MdrpjbLWscQPYnsgUMpVo3fFoFP7vh2By
transaction
e66f5a53652b201562019bfbee0433d0426105309b724d51a183d6aac7e50668
spent
true